Official title
Effects for Individuals Following a Health Intervention Programme in Halsnaes Municipality; A Sub-project Under the Initiative: Quality Development in Community Healthcare: Steno Tvaers
Overview
Based on the Danish Health Authority's quality standards for municipal prevention services for citizens with chronic diseases, Steno Diabetes Center Copenhagen (SDCC), Halsnaes Municipality, North Zealand Hospital, and others have entered into a cross-sectoral collaboration entitled "Quality Development in Community Healthcare: Steno Tvaers - A Model for Differentiated Health Interventions for Citizens with Diabetes, Chronic Obstructive Pulmonary Disease (COPD), or Cardiovascular Disease sased in Halsnaes Municipality" (hereafter referred to as Steno Tvaers). Based in Halsnaes Municipality, the aim of Steno Tvaers is to adapt and, where relevant, supplement existing healthcare services in the municipality to better meet the needs of and reach all citizens with chronic diseases. The present sub-project "Measurements before and after participation in a health intervention programme in Halsnaes Municipality" (hereafter referred to as the sub-project) is conducted within the framework of Steno Tvaers. The objective of the current sub-project is to assess whether citizens with diabetes, COPD, or cardiovascular disease, who participate in a health intervention programme in Halsnaes Municipality, improve their functional capacity. For citizens with diabetes, the sub-project also aims to assess whether participation in the programme results in improved blood glucose concentration, blood pressure, and medical adherence. The hypothesis of the sub-project is that the organizational changes planned within Steno Tvaers for successful implementation of the quality standards will lead to a resulting health effect at the individual level. It is important to note that the healthcare interventions are existing services, the quality and uptake of which are being enhanced through the Steno Tvaers project, and that this does not involve testing a new intervention. Participation in the project therefore only involves contributing data that are already being collected by the municipality, supplemented by responses to two questionnaires. For citizens with diabetes, this is further supplemented with data on blood glucose (HbA1c), blood pressure, attendance at follow-up visits with general practitioners and in hospital settings, as well as adherence to prescribed medication. Data are collected at the beginning and at the end of a health intervention programme, and at the end of the project, the data will be linked to selected national registers.
Detailed description
The study will recruit citizens who are offered a health programme provided by Halsnaes Municipality and invite all citizens who live up to the inclusion criteria in the project period (with inclusion of a maximum of 200 citizens). Thus, purposive sampling, where the study staff target people who represent a specific demographic for study participation, is used. Statistical considerations:
A power calculation based on WHODAS 2.0 shows that, using a two-sided paired t-test and aiming to detect a minimal clinically relevant difference of 3.0 points in functional ability (ΔSD = 9.1), with 90% power, the study requires complete data from 97 participants. Accounting for an expected dropout rate and/or missing data of 50%, the project needs to include 194 participants. A descriptive analysis of the study population's demographics will be conducted based on descriptive data from the municipality's electronic health record system, national registers, and information from citizen interviews and questionnaire responses, in order to characterize the participant population.
To examine whether the organizational changes planned in Steno Tvaers lead to more citizens participating in and being retained in a municipal health programme, the uptake in the subproject population with the current uptake in the municipality will be compared.
To examine whether the organizational changes lead to downstream health effects at the individual level, differences in functional ability (muscle strength, well-being, health-related quality of life, as well as WHODAS-assessed functioning and disability) from the start to the end of a municipal health programme will be analyzed. Similarly, changes in blood glucose and blood pressure among citizens with diabetes will be analyzed. Changes in medical adherence (attendance and medication use) among citizens with diabetes will be measured as the number of annual check-ups each citizen attends, as well as the proportion of prescriptions redeemed relative to the number prescribed between baseline and end of the health programme.
Multiple linear regression (linear mixed models) will be used to analyze these changes over time (as there is no control group, only changes over time can be analyzed), including relevant covariates such as sociodemographic and health-related data from registers. Stratified analyses based on sociodemographic and health-related strata will also be conducted if relevant. The primary analyses will be performed after completion of the subproject but will also be conducted midway through the subproject period for those citizens who have completed a health programme by that time, although without linkage to national registers. Researchers from SDCC will assist with analyses and interpretation.
Primary outcome measures
- Functional capacity [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
Secondary outcome measures (9)
- Muscle strength and physical function [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Mental well-being (WHO-5) [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Health and Disability (WHODAS 2.0) [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Attendance at annual diabetes check-ups [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Redemption of prescribed diabetes medication [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Glycated hemoglobin (HbA1c) [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Systolic blood pressure [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Diastolic blood pressure [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
- Heart rate [Time frame: From the start of a health intervention programme to the end of the health intervention programme (at 5-25 weeks).]
Eligibility criteria
Inclusion criteria
- Diagnosis of type 2 diabetes, chronic obstructive pulmonary disease, or cardiovascular disease
- At or above 18 years of age
- Offered a health programme provided by Halsnæs Municipality
Exclusion criteria
- None
